A small plane crash landed on a soccer field at a park in a Long Beach neighborhood Tuesday afternoon, injuring the pilot and ...
A deaf woman was seriously injured when a small plane crash landed on a soccer field in California, her family said.
The pilot declared an emergency about three miles east of Long Beach Airport, then later said he didn’t think he’d make it to ...